|
KDE 4.0.0相对KDE 3的程序组件出入
这里列出的是KDE 4.0.0相对KDE 3.5,已被永久或暂时清走/替代的程序组件或功能部件(不保证完全列举,但囊括了绝大多数能体会到的),大多是移植进度不及所致或有创新,不涉及类库部分。如果您打算升级自己的桌面,请先参考。
基本工具
声音服务器aRts:被淘汰,以Phonon声音抽象层取代,目前首选的Phonon后端是Xine。
桌面通讯协议DCOP:被应用程序通讯服务D-Bus取代。
控制中心KControl:被同功能的systemsettings取代。
打印子系统KDEPrint:因为KDEPrint未来得及跟上通用UNIX打印系统CUPS的发展,需重新回炉,在KDE 4.0.0中尚未完成。不过用户仍然可以在KDE里直接调用CUPS内配置的打印机,但没有KDE 3里那样的控制界面。暂时缺失的内容包括打印机配置模块、CUPS配置程序、打印任务管理器、kio_print、KDEPrint的KParts组件等一系列相关组件。
桌面定制向导KPersonalizer:尽管它是一个在KDE3初次启动时会自动运行的基本定制向导,对新用户的起步非常友好,但相信大多用户根本没见过,因为大多数发行版都禁用掉了这个,天晓得他们哪根筋抽了要干这种自作聪明的事。好吧,现在它也没有了。
文件管理器Dolphin:新组件,纯粹的文件管理器,能和Konqueror整合运行。但原先的文件管理器kfmclient依然保留。
脚本引擎Kross:新组件,原属KOffice 1.6。主要面向开发者。
拼写检查中间层Sonnet:新组件,框架性质的变更,意义主要面向开发者。
媒体介质访问KIO管道kio_media:暂无维护者,移除,对用户影响不大。
“桌面”程序KDesktop、面板程序Kicker:改由全新的桌面外壳框架Plasma取代。
增加程序启动器KRunner。
顺便说一下,原属基本组件的高级文本编辑器Kate现被移入开发工具,不再进入基本组件,但KWrite的归属不变。
网络工具
即时通讯程序Kopete原有的Jingle语音会话、网络摄像头、Meanwhile协议三个功能组件在KDE 4版本中暂不支持。
无线网络配置程序KWiFiManager:这部分功能被Solid的网络设备后端替换掉了。
IRC客户端KSirc:没有后续维护者,被清理了。不过KDE还有个更好的第三方IRC客户端Konversation,可以等它移植完成后使用。同时,Kopete也有基本的IRC功能。
局域网通讯程序ktalkd:同上,因失去维护而被清理。
文件共享小程序kpf:很实用的小程序,可惜因暂无维护者而被移除。
局域网服务探索部件LISA:含kio_lan等。失去维护已经很久了,故已移除,而且在功能上和Zeroconf有重叠。
新闻点点通KNewsTicker:改用Plasma部件实现,不再作为独立程序。
在线词典KDict:被移除,原因未知。
个人信息管理工具
因在移植过程中留下大量工作未完成,很多程序的质量离发布要求还有一定距离,所以整个kdepim套件完全被剥离出KDE 4.0.0,其中包括个人信息管理套件Kontact、邮件客户端KMail、信息助理KOrganizer、计划任务程序KAlarm等等。
预计重新加入要到KDE 4.1。
图形图像工具
KPDF、KDVI、KGhostView、KFax、KFaxView、KViewShell、KView:各种文档格式的独立查看程序已全部合并为一个新的通用文档查看器Okular,独立组件都被移除,日后很可能不再受维护。有个例外是KFax的G3/G4 raw格式传真图像文件支持还没有在Okular里实现,所以它还在extragear程序仓库中。
图像浏览器KuickShow:被另一个移植自KDE3的原extragear(可理解作非官方直属控制的项目,但联系紧密的一组程序总称。下同)Gwenview取代。
图像索引服务KMRML、扫描仪程序Kooka:暂时因失去维护而被移除。
调色程序KColorEditor、图标编辑器KIconEdit、PovRay建模器KPovModeler:转入extragear仓库,不再属kdegraphics。
多媒体程序
和aRts、aKode紧密相关的全部移除,包括滤波设计器aRtsBuilder、高级aRts控制界面aRtsControl、录音程序KRec、简单媒体播放器Kaboodle,以及众多解码插件。
CD抓轨程序KAudioCreator:转入extragear仓库,其实有kio_audiocd这个就不需要了。
多媒体播放程序Noatun:KDE 4版本尚未就绪,暂不发布。
杂类程序(可理解为Windows中的“附件”)
简单文本编辑器KEdit:被转移到extragear仓库,前途不明。
正则表达式编辑器KRegExpEditor:内部功能未能紧跟界面移植到Qt4,且暂时无维护者,暂时没法用,被移除。
桌面分页器KPager:相应功能改以plasma部件代替。
特殊面板KSim、笔记本电脑增强支持部件klaptopdaemon、红外遥控辅助程序kdelirc、特殊字符选取小程序charsetapplet:待Plasma移植,目前默认不会编译。
十六进制文件编辑器KHexEdit:缺少维护者且移植未全部完成,暂被移除。4.1时可能会由同功能的Okteta取代。
增加系统清理程序Sweeper,即原KDE控制中心里相应功能的独立形态。
系统管理工具
磁带备份前端KDat、启动服务编辑器KSysv:未移植完成,暂移除。
辅助工具
即输即读语音合成前端KSayit:目前还不能编译。
教学程序
拉丁语学习工具KLatin:缺少维护人员,被扫除。
另外原先的词汇练习程序KVocTrain已改名为Parley。
增加函数绘图程序KAlgebra和桌面地球仪Marble。
游戏和小玩具
大富翁类游戏Atlantik、空间射击游戏KAsteroids、棋盘游戏Kenolaba、色块消去游戏KLickety、仿玛利医生游戏KFoulEggs、变种俄罗斯方块KSmileTris、对抗性贪吃蛇KSnake、仓库世家类游戏KSokoban、微型密室对抗游戏KTron、“少尉”纸牌游戏Lieutenant Skat:因为没有志愿者将这些游戏移植到SVG外观,在有志愿者完成此项工作前它们将不会进入KDE 4。
西洋双陆棋KBackgammon、梭哈扑克KPoker、标准俄罗斯方块KSirtet:SVG外观移植尚未完成,故不进入KDE 4.0.0。
四子连珠游戏KWin4因名称歧义关系已改名为KFourInLine。
鼠标里程计Kodo:暂不知原因。
增加快艇骰子游戏Kiriki、五子棋游戏Bovo、方块游戏KSquares和数独游戏KSudoku。
附现有KDE 4游戏的具体现状列表:http://techbase.kde.org/Projects/Games/Status_KDE_4.0
开发工具
程序调用视图程序KSpy、单元测试程序KUnitest、界面检查插件kstyle_scheck:未移植完成。
本地化集成工作环境KBabel:无后续维护者,但有一个同用途程序KAider将取代它,预估在KDE 4.1时进入发布。
XSLT调试器KXSLDbg、Web开发环境Quanta:和KDE集成开发平台kdevplatform的整合工作未完成,暂不包含于官方发布中。
对话框编辑器Kommander:这原本是一个基于DCOP的程序,在DCOP被取代后前途不明,暂未包含。
语言绑定
C#语言绑定Qt#:原先的Qt#早已终止多年了,现改由全新的Qyoto取代。
Perl的DCOP绑定、Python的DCOP绑定、C的DCOP绑定:随着DCOP被D-Bus取代,这些自然也被移除,相应的D-Bus绑定,基本都已经有了现存的独立实现,且不属KDE项目下。
Java的Qt/KDE绑定Koala:Qt厂商已经提供了官方的Java绑定套件,独立发行,Koala因此不再有意义(本来也很有限),被移除。
ECMA脚本对KDE的绑定KJSEmbed:成功进入KDE基本组件中的kdelibs,不再属于这个发布包。
额外插件(即原kdeaddons)
仍然保留的将全部和宿主程序整合在同一发布包内,KDE 4.0时不再予独立成件。其余一些插件随着宿主程序被移除而一同被移除,还有一些因失去维护而暂时被移除,其中包括二进制时钟、颜色撷取器、月相显示、数学表达式计算器等,这些都是原嵌入在Kicker面板里的小程序,日后如果重新出现将会以Plasma部件的形式存在。
有个例外是签名编辑器KSig,转入extragear。 |
|